2011 European Championships - A Section

Date:
Saturday, April 30, 2011

Venue:
Stravinski Hall, Montreaux, Switzerland

Test piece:
Audivi Media Nocte, Oliver Waespi and Own Choice

Adjudicator(s):
Frode Amundson, Eric Crees and Thomas Doss [SW] Blaise Heritier, Luc Vertommen and Allan Withington [OC]

Pos Band Conductor Dr Pts
1 Manger Musikklag [Norway]
Old Licks Bluesed Up - T. Aagaard-Nilsen
Peter Szilvay 4/6 94(1)/97(2)=191
2 Cory Band [Wales]
From Ancient Times - J. Van der Roost
Dr Robert Childs 2/10 89(5)/98(1)=187
3 Tredegar [Wales]
Destroy Trample as Swiftly as She - G. Higgins
Ian Porthouse 5/9 90(4)/96(=3)=186
4 Brass Band Schoonhoven [Netherlands]
Music of the Spheres - P. Sparke
Erik Jannsen 10/4 91(3)/94(5)=185
5 Noord-Limburgse [Belgium]
Montage - P. Graham
Ivan Meylemans 7/2 92(2)/92(7)=184
6 Fairey (Geneva) [England]
Symphony of Colours - S. Dobson
Russell Gray 3/5 87(6)/93(6)=180
7 Treize-Etoiles [Switzerland]
Concerto for Brass Band - K. Downie
James Gourlay 1/3 83(9)/96(=3)=179
8 Windcorp[Sweden]
Rococo Variations - Prof E. Gregson
Garry Cutt 9/8 86(7)/89(9)=175
9 Lyngby-Taarbaek [Denmark]
A Tales as Yet Untold - P. Sparke
Selmer Simonsen 6/1 85(8)/90(8)=175
10 Kingdom Brass [Scotland]
Titan's Progress - H. Pallhuber
Andrew Duncan 8/7 81(10)/84(9)=165

[SW] Set Work
[OC] Own Choice

Best Soloist:
Bert van Thienan [Soprano] — Cory
